Ingredients:
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up Baileys Irish Cream
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 6 graham crackers
- 6 large marshmallows
- 3 ounces milk chocolate, roughly chopped
- Optional: Chocolate shavings for garnish
Instructions:
Step 1: Prepare the Baileys Cream:
In a medium bowl, whisk together the heavy cream, Baileys Irish Cream, sugar, and vanilla extract until stiff peaks form. This should take about 2-3 minutes with an electric mixer. If you don't have an electric mixer, you can certainly do this by hand, but it will require more effort and time.
Step 2: Assemble the S'mores:
Lay out three graham crackers on a serving plate or baking sheet. Top each graham cracker with a generous spoonful of the Baileys cream.
Step 3: Add the Chocolate and Marshmallows:
Sprinkle the chopped milk chocolate evenly over the Baileys cream. Top each with two large marshmallows.
Step 4: Broil (Optional):
For that perfectly toasted marshmallow effect, broil the s'mores for 1-2 minutes, or until the marshmallows are golden brown and slightly puffed. Keep a close eye on them to prevent burning.
Step 5: Serve and Enjoy:
Carefully top each with another graham cracker to create a delightful s'more sandwich. Garnish with chocolate shavings, if desired. Serve immediately and enjoy the warm, gooey, and boozy goodness!
Tips for S'mores Success:
- Chill the cream: For best results, chill the heavy cream in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before whipping. This will help it whip up to a firmer consistency.
- Don't over-whip: Over-whipping the cream can result in a grainy texture. Stop whipping as soon as stiff peaks form.
- Adjust sweetness: If you prefer a less sweet dessert, reduce the amount of sugar to your liking.
- Use good quality chocolate: The quality of your chocolate will greatly impact the overall flavor of the s'mores.
Variations:
- Different Liqueurs: Experiment with other liqueurs like coffee liqueur or hazelnut liqueur for a unique twist.
- Dark Chocolate: Substitute dark chocolate for milk chocolate for a more intense flavor.
- Fruit additions: Add fresh berries or sliced bananas to the Baileys cream for extra flavor and texture.
